Bespoke furniture manufacture is a craft that combines creativity and craftsmanship to create one-of-a-kind pieces tailored to individual tastes and needs. In a world of mass-produced furniture, bespoke stands out as a personalized, unique option.
Skilled artisans work closely with clients, listening to their ideas and vision for the perfect piece. They consider not only aesthetics but also functionality and practicality. Each project is a collaboration, where the client’s input is invaluable.
The materials used in bespoke furniture are carefully selected, often of superior quality, ensuring longevity and durability. Craftsmen pay meticulous attention to detail, from precise measurements to intricate joinery, resulting in furniture that is not just beautiful but built to last.
One of the most appealing aspects of bespoke furniture is its exclusivity. Clients have the opportunity to own something truly distinctive, reflecting their style and personality. Whether it’s a custom dining table, a unique bookshelf, or a tailored wardrobe, each piece tells a story.
Moreover, bespoke furniture is sustainable. It promotes responsible consumption by encouraging clients to invest in pieces that won’t need frequent replacement. Plus, local artisans often use locally-sourced materials, reducing the carbon footprint.
In the digital age, where mass production dominates, bespoke furniture manufacture preserves the art of craftsmanship. It celebrates individuality, sustainability, and the timeless beauty of handcrafted creations. It’s a testament to the enduring value of artisanal skills in our fast-paced world.
